The Signature250 is an ideal, cost-efficient instrument for users looking for long range current profiling and directional waves, but without the need for the full 1000 meter range of its big brother – the Signature55. The aptly named Signature250 has a frequency of 250 kHz with a profiling range of 200 meters. It is capable of measuring directional waves, ice thickness and ice drift from up-looking installations of up to 150 meters depth.

This 250 kHz frequency, true broadband instrument brings you a host of features and benefits carefully developed around the needs of the scientists and engineers working both within academia and in the offshore industry.
It has been designed with a broad range of applications in mind: Nortek has built a rugged, robust system optimized for operational users, while also offering innovation in data investigation capabilities and accuracy to scientific researchers.
The system is ideal for investigating:
- Ocean circulation, including boundary currents, inter-basin exchange and transport in and out of the polar seas
- Deep water wave climate
- Ice thickness and drift velocity
Just like the rest of the Signature series products, the Signature250 brings you the convenience of:
- Smaller size and lighter weight. The instrument weighs only 1,5 kg in water (18,5 kg in air) without batteries and the height is less than 55 cm.
- Hard-iron calibration in post-processing. Calibrate data for hard-iron effects around the sensor platform during post-processing.
- Ethernet Interface. Download one GB in 6 minutes! Connect directly to your in-house network.
- Meticulous QC. Single ping data may be stored.
- True Broadband technology. Reduced power consumption by a factor of 10-30 compared to more traditional systems.
- Concurrent and alternate sampling schemes. Powered by the patented AD2CP platform (US Patent 7,911,880), concurrent and alternate sampling schemes are available for maximum flexibility.
